B'nei Yisrael: Worshipping Yah with Music
Throughout their journey, the people of B'nei Yisrael have demonstrated their profound devotion to Yah through the power of music. From the jubilant sounds of the Sanctuary during festivals to the stirring laments marking times of difficulty, music has served as an integral part of their spiritual worship. Traditional instruments, such as the shofar, the pipe, and the kinnor, created a rich tapestry of sound, enhancing the atmosphere of prayer and joy. Even today, contemporary Jewish musical artists continue to innovate traditional topics with modern approaches, ensuring that the tradition of praising Yah through music persists a significant feature of B'nei Yisrael culture.
Biblical Worship: Traditional Hebrew Songs
Delving into Israelite worship practices offers a fascinating glimpse into the sacred heart of early Israel. While modern presentations often incorporate contemporary musical elements, attempts to reconstruct original Hebrew melodies – those sung during the Tabernacle periods – remain a captivating pursuit. Researchers use textual clues, comparative studies with contemporary cultures, and a extensive understanding of Hebrew grammar and poetry to construct what these holy songs might have sounded like. This isn't simply about reconstructing a tune; it's about connecting with the spiritual landscape of ancient Judah and experiencing a renewed appreciation for their devotion to the Divine.

Roots of Israel: Ancient Praise Revived
A remarkable movement is sweeping across Israel, demonstrating a fresh resurgent appreciation for traditional Jewish musical legacy. The rediscovery and rendition of liturgical chants, known as Pi'yutim, composed centuries ago, is captivating audiences and fostering a deeper connection to their forefather's faith. What was once largely confined to scholarly study is now experiencing a vibrant rebirth, with young singers and musicians embracing these complex and evocative melodies. This renewed focus on religious music isn't merely a nostalgic endeavor; it’s a powerful expression of Jewish belonging and a poignant reminder of the enduring spirit of prayer and praise throughout generations, bringing long-forgotten copyright of praise back to life. It presents a beautiful opportunity for Israelis of all backgrounds to engage with a pivotal piece of their history.
